Pharmaceutical machinery plays a crucial role in the manufacturing process of drugs in the modern pharmaceutical industry. Among the various types of pharmaceutical machinery used, the table press machine and capsule filling machine are essential for the production of solid dosage forms.
The table press machine, also known as a tablet press, is a mechanical device that compresses powder into tablets of uniform size and weight. This machine is commonly used in the pharmaceutical industry to produce tablets with precise dosages of active pharmaceutical ingredients. On the other hand, the capsule filling machine is used to fill empty capsules with powdered or granular materials. This machine is crucial for the production of capsules that contain a precise amount of active ingredients. Capsule filling machines are available in different configurations, including manual, semi-automatic, and automatic models. These machines offer high efficiency and accuracy in filling capsules, contributing to the overall quality of the finished pharmaceutical products.
